About 2 Beavens Court
2 Beavens Court is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Warminster (BA12 9BS). It has a recorded floor area of 109 m² (around 1173 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(May 2024) shows a C (score 69), just inside the C band. When first surveyed in October 2013 the rating was D,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Poor to Good and lighting went from Poor to Very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 88).
4 planning records sit against the property, 3 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include tree works,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. At 109 m² it's 16.6% larger than the typical home in the postcode (94 m² median across 4 EPCs). Its energy rating outperforms most of the postcode (better than 75% of similar EPCs). Across 1997–2020, sale prices on this property compounded at 5%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£315,000 is 34% above the 2020 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£200/sq ft) was about 43.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Most recent transfer: November 2020 at £235,000.
